Getting to Canterbury Village
Getting to Canterbury Village is relatively easy, but it’s important to plan ahead to avoid traffic and other potential delays. If you’re driving from Detroit, take I-75 North to exit 83 for Joslyn Road. Turn right on Joslyn Road and follow it for about two miles until you reach the entrance to Canterbury Village on the left.
